Bleeding in the upper gastrointestinal (GI) tract causes serious health problemsand even early deathsfor many patients with kidney failure, according to a study appearing in an upcoming issue of the Journal of the American Society Nephrology (JASN). The findings indicate that greater efforts are needed to prevent and treat upper GI bleeding in these patients.
